How much do foot messenger j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for foot messenger in Texas is $16.16,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.09 and $17.93 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a foot messenger?

Foot messengers are individuals who deliver documents, packages, or messages by walking rather than using vehicles. They typically operate in urban areas where traffic congestion makes walking a faster and more reliable method for short-distance deliveries. Their duties often include picking up items from businesses or individuals and delivering them promptly to the intended recipients. Foot messengers need to be familiar with local streets, possess good time management skills, and maintain a professional appearance when interacting with cl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a foot messenger,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Foot Messenger, you need strong physical stamina, time management, and basic literacy skills, often with a high school diploma as the minimum qualification. Familiarity with city navigation tools, GPS devices, and mobile communication apps is typically required. Reliability, attention to detail, and excellent interpersonal skills help you stand out in this fast-paced role. These skills ensure timely and accurate delivery of packages or messages, maintaining client satisfaction and efficient workflow.

What are some common challenges faced by foot messengers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Foot Messengers often face challenges such as navigating busy city streets, inclement weather, and managing time-sensitive deliveries. Staying organized with a clear route plan and using navigation apps can help streamline deliveries and minimize delays. Building strong communication with dispatchers and clients is also important to ensure timely updates and problem-solving if unexpected obstacles arise. Proper footwear and weather-appropriate clothing can make the job more comfortable and efficient.

The main difference between a Foot Messenger and a Courier lies in their mode of transportation and scope. Foot Messengers typically deliver within local areas on foot, often for small businesses or restaurants, requiring minimal credentials. Couriers may use bikes or vehicles to cover larger distances and may need specific licenses. Both roles are essential in the delivery industry but differ mainly in their work environment and delivery range.
